Common HVAC Problems Homeowners Face

  • Poor Airflow
    Restricted air flow makes your system work harder and minimizes convenience. Our HVAC professionals recognize airflow problems, whether caused by duct issues, filthy filters, or fan issues.
  • Irregular Heating or Cooling
    If some rooms are too hot while others are too cold, you may have duct problems, insulation issues, or an incorrectly sized system. Our expert HVAC specialists can detect these issues and recommend options.
  • Brief Cycling
    When your system switches on and off frequently, it loses energy and wears components much faster. Our HVAC professionals can determine whether the problem originates from a clogged up filter, incorrect thermostat settings, or something more major.
  • High Energy Bills
    Unexpected boosts in energy costs often indicate HVAC inefficiency. Our professionals carry out energy performance assessments to determine the cause and suggest improvements.
  • Humidity Problems
    Modern HVAC systems must help manage indoor humidity. If your home feels too humid in summer season or too dry in winter season, our HVAC professionals can recommend services to enhance comfort and air quality.
  • Thermostat Problems
    Often what seems like a system failure is actually a thermostat problem. Our HVAC contractors can fix or change thermostats and assist you upgrade to programmable or wise designs for better convenience control and energy savings.

Preparing for HVAC Emergencies

  • Keep Contact Information Handy
    Store our emergency number 888-409-7841 in your phone so you can reach us quickly when required.
  • Know Your System Basics
    Familiarize yourself with the place of your HVAC equipment and how to shut it off in case of emergency.
  • Perform Regular Maintenance
    Regular professional upkeep lowers the likelihood of emergency situations. Our HVAC contractors can establish a maintenance schedule for your system.
  • Set Up Carbon Monoxide Detectors
    If you have combustion heating devices, carbon monoxide detectors provide an early warning of hazardous leaks.
